The Career of a Psychologist


What is your job?

A psychologist perform examinations and research to study all the aspects of the mind. People come to see them for any problem related to how they feel emotionally or because of mental health issues.


Where do you work?

A clinical psychologist can work in many places but for most of them private practice is the goal. They can also work in hospital, schools or in any type of work environment. There's also psychologist who only do research. This type of psychologist don't see any patient, and they work in labs.

Is it a popular job in your country?

There's a high demand for psychologist in my country but because it takes a Ph.D there's not a lot of people that actually practices.

How much money do psychologist make?

Psychologist make on average $118 000 per year in Quebec. The salary can vary a lot depending on where you work, for how long you've been working at the same place and also if you're in a private office or not.


How can i become a Psychologist?

To become a psychologist you'll have to go through 2 years of CEGEP and 5 to 7 years of university. You can't practice if you don't obtain a Ph.D.

What kind of illness a psychologist can treat?

It extends between serious mental health problem like schizophrenia or borderline personality disorder and more common disorder like panic attacks and anxiety or anger issues.


What age do a psychologist retire at?

A psychologist can retire whenever he wants if he's the private system but if he works for the government he can only retire around the age of 65.
